User Depot Module- UDM
• UDM Launched in 2020 • Fully integrated with iMMS, IREPS, IPAS, AIMS, RITES, RDSO, TPI Agencies, IRPSM, TMS, SLAM • Benefits- Computerisation of entire supply chain, cost reduction and economy, Traceability of material, real time exchange for information, enhanced efficiency and transparency. User Depot Module- UDM • UDM have easy access for computerising various material management activities at the end of user Depots, i.e, consignees authorised users have been enabled for creation of • Computerised Ledgers • Daily material transaction reports • For recording Receipt & issue transactions by authorised users • Receipt of stores- By user Depots/ Consignees against orders/ GeM orders/Contracts User Depot Module- UDM • Issue of material: to end user, to ther user Depots/ Consignees on Assistance/Loan Basis, to contractors, on book transfer within same user depot, to stores depots on Advice Notes, to purchasers for Scrap delivers etc., • Placing of requisitions on stores Depot for stock items and Non-stock items (S1313 as well as imprest Demands) • Placing of Demands on user Depots/Consignees: Issue Note, Gate Pass, Adjustments Memo etc., • Transacting with Non-computerised user Depots/ Consignees w.r.t Receipt & issue of material. User Depot Module- UDM • Integration of payment activities on IPAS with Digitally signed consignee receipt Note (CRN), consignee receipt Certificated (CRC) being generated in UDM • Rejection Handling: Both Initial rejection as well as warranty rejection • Stock verification (Accounts/ Departmental & Stock sheet management. • Accessing Several MIS/Exception Reports. • Real time information exchange: among various stake –holders leading to enhanced operational efficiency, economy and transparency. User Depot Module- UDM • All officers of the Railways where in UDM has been made live, have been given access using their existing user name/ Password on IREPS (as used by them for works/stores Tenders) • User officer is Admin, Admin can have rights for mapping of consignee code, iMMS ID & Sub- consignee. • User ID/Password currently being used on iMMS cannot be used for UDM • Requirements to perform UDM- Valid DSC, Consignee code, email ID and infrastructure & software. User Depot Module- UDM • Admin Functions- Manage Sections, Manage Posts, manage users, update department details, consignee mapping/Unmapping/creation & deletion of sub consignee/ secondary user/ look after management , approve of NS and S1313 Indents etc., • User creation- user creation is 4 types - consignee code mapping of Depot main user - sub consignee - secondary user - look after user
